Meaning
🌟🫶 works like shorthand for shine with warm support on top. It is a compact way to show tone when you do not want to over-explain.
The tone is caring and genuine and slightly more pointed than shine alone. It gives the message a clearer direction.
You get a clean visual: 🌟 up front, 🫶 as the mood cue. Flip the order if you want the accent to lead.
Order Note
Keep them adjacent to read as one idea. A space or dot makes it feel like two separate reactions.
Where It Works
DM
In DMs, 🌟🫶 feels caring and genuine with a more personal edge. It works when you want a fast signal without overexplaining, and it reads like one unified thought. If you want softer energy, pair it with a short line of text. It signals closeness without spelling it out.
ExampleNeeded this today 🌟🫶
Captions
For captions, 🌟🫶 sets a warm support tone that frames the whole post. Keep it tight when you want the combo to feel intentional, not decorative. It works best when the visual already carries the same emotion. When used alone, the combo becomes the headline.
ExampleSoft mood, loud feelings 🌟🫶
Comments
In comments, it signals you are backing the mood, not just reacting. The warm support accent makes it feel more deliberate than a single emoji.
ExampleThis hit me — 🌟🫶
